Step by step

Instructions

  1. 1

    Prep Pan and Bacon

    Line a rimmed baking sheet with foil, extending it up the sides to catch grease. Optionally place a wire rack on top for better airflow and crispier bacon. Lay strips in a single layer — close but not overlapping. No oil or extra seasoning needed.

  2. 2

    Hornea a 400°F durante 14–22 Minutos

    Ajusta el horno a 400°F. Puedes comenzar el tocino en un horno frío mientras se precalienta, o esperar hasta que esté completamente precalentado — ambos funcionan. Usa un termómetro externo si tu horno funciona de manera inexacta. Comienza a verificar en 14–15 minutos. Corte delgado: 10–14 min. Corte estándar: 15–20 min. Corte grueso: 20–22 min. No necesitas voltear. Verifica cada un par de minutos después de la primera verificación — lo sobrecocido sucede rápido. Extrae el tocino justo antes de que se vea listo; continúa cocinándose uno o dos minutos fuera del calor.

  3. 3

    Drain, Rest, Serve

    Transfer bacon to a paper-towel-lined plate immediately. Rest for at least a few minutes — it keeps crisping as it cools. Don't skip this; slightly underdone bacon on the pan often hits perfect crispiness after resting. To save the fat, let it cool on the foil for ~10 minutes until liquid but not dangerously hot, then pour into a heat-safe jar. Pull bacon slightly early — it finishes cooking off the heat and can go from perfect to overdone fast.
